  • Is SWCC training like SEAL training?

  • @Lootraevefan Yes and no. Swicks go through a similar pipeline, their training is mainly focused on operating the three types of crafts. Still, they are cross trained in CQB, small unit tactics and demo, MFF - just like the SEAL Teams. Its done in case a SEAL platon need more shooters, then boat guys step in and they need (and ARE) to be just as effective as Frogs are.
